• A novel 3D model has been developed to simulate the alveolar–vascular barrier in vitro. • PM2.5 exposure increased EGF and TNF-α expression in pulmonary epithelial cells. • EGF and TNF-α secreted by pulmonary epithelial cells transmit signals to vascular endothelial cells. • EGF and TNF-α regulate Nrf2 and CYP1A1expression in endothelial cells via the PI3K/Akt pathway. • Reveal the molecular link between alveolar injury and vascular endothelial dysfunction.
